Lines Matching defs:ToRemove
1403 SmallVectorImpl<Instruction *> &ToRemove) {
1425 ToRemove.push_back(Cmp);
1437 SmallVectorImpl<Instruction *> &ToRemove) {
1441 ToRemove.push_back(MinMax);
1457 SmallVectorImpl<Instruction *> &ToRemove) {
1462 ToRemove.push_back(I);
1467 ToRemove.push_back(I);
1472 ToRemove.push_back(I);
1618 SmallVectorImpl<Instruction *> &ToRemove) {
1636 ToRemove.push_back(I);
1651 SmallVectorImpl<Instruction *> &ToRemove) {
1672 Changed = replaceSubOverflowUses(II, A, B, ToRemove);
1731 SmallVector<Instruction *> ToRemove;
1766 Changed |= tryToSimplifyOverflowMath(II, Info, ToRemove);
1770 ReproducerModule.get(), ReproducerCondStack, S.DT, ToRemove);
1779 Changed |= checkAndReplaceMinMax(MinMax, Info, ToRemove);
1781 Changed |= checkAndReplaceCmp(CmpIntr, Info, ToRemove);
1879 for (Instruction *I : ToRemove)